What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in accounting manager jobs.
- Bachelor's degree in accounting, finance, or a related field
- 5 or more years of progressive accounting experience including supervisory responsibility
- Proficiency in ERP systems such as NetSuite, SAP, Oracle, or QuickBooks
- CPA certification required or strongly preferred
- Experience managing month-end and year-end close processes
- Strong knowledge of GAAP and internal controls
Tips for Your Accounting Manager Job Search
Tailor your resume to close cycles
Accounting managers are evaluated on their ability to close books accurately and on time. Quantify your close cycle length, the size of the team you supervised, and any reductions in error rates you achieved. Vague descriptions of 'overseeing accounting functions' won't stand out.
Highlight the software stack you own
Most postings specify ERP systems like NetSuite, SAP, or Oracle, plus Excel or reporting tools. List every system you've administered or configured, not just used. Hiring managers distinguish between someone who enters data and someone who owns the chart of accounts.
Target postings by company growth stage
Early-stage companies want accounting managers who can build processes from scratch. Established firms want someone who can optimize existing workflows and manage audits. Match your resume's emphasis to where the company is, not a one-size-fits-all summary.

Prepare for a technical case in interviews
Many accounting manager interviews include a scenario question: a journal entry dispute, a reconciliation discrepancy, or a month-end close problem. Walk through your thought process out loud. Interviewers want to see how you triage and communicate, not just whether you know debits from credits.
Negotiate beyond base salary thoughtfully
Accounting manager offers often include bonus eligibility tied to close quality or audit outcomes. Ask specifically about bonus structure, CPA exam reimbursement, and professional development budgets. These vary significantly and are almost always negotiable before you sign.

How do you become an accounting manager?
Start by earning a bachelor's degree in accounting or finance, then build several years of experience in staff or senior accountant roles where you own reconciliations and close processes. Earning a CPA license significantly accelerates the path. From there, take on supervisory responsibility, even informally, and demonstrate you can manage deadlines, review others' work, and communicate results to leadership.
Can you get hired as an accounting manager with limited management experience?
Yes, especially if you've led projects, mentored junior staff, or managed workflows without a formal supervisory title. Emphasize any cross-functional coordination, process improvements you drove independently, and times you presented financials to non-accounting stakeholders. Smaller companies and growth-stage organizations are more likely to promote or hire strong senior accountants into their first management role.
What does the accounting manager interview process look like?
Most processes include an initial recruiter screen, a technical interview covering close processes, GAAP knowledge, and system experience, and then a panel or hiring manager round focused on leadership scenarios. Some employers add a take-home case study involving a reconciliation problem or a close process analysis. References are typically checked before an offer is extended.
